Each cash drawer driver will source 24 volts for 75 ms to the “solenoid +” pin of the appropri-
ate RJ-11 jack when the proper cash drawer command is executed. The cash drawer com-
mand must be preceded by a line terminator. The command for the cash drawer may vary for
the Compatibility Mode selected.
Cash Drawer
Warning: This Printer is designed for use only with Pertech Resources A470 / DH Tech-
nology 4700 compatible cash drawers. Damage can result if the A470 is connected to a
cash drawer that is incompatible. The cash drawer solenoid resistance must be at least
25 ohms or damage to the printer could result.

Power Supply

The A470 printer uses a NTRL Certied external switching power source with a Limited Power
Source (LPS) output for use in North America, input 100-240 Vac, 50/60 Hz, 1.5 A, with a
maximum power consumption of 60 watts, output is rated at 24 Vdc,2.5A.
The power cable connector is a Mini-Din Barrel Connector and is located at the back or the
printer.
Use of this product with a power supply other than the Pertech power supply will require you
to test this power supply and Pertech printer for FCC and CE mark Certications. ( See FCC
Radio Frequency Interference Statement on page iii of this manual).
